I only want to help..... I have been to greenwood from time to time. Usually just to buy brine shrimp for my fish. Every time I go, the place gets filthier.

I stopped in today. Besides the whole puppy mill thing (and responsible breeders DO NOT sell their puppies to brokers or pet stores...period), the animals are in terrible living conditions, the place stinks to high heaven, and several of the fish were extremely skinny. I stopped in to peek at kittens. They have signs posted..."Kitten prices-regular-$99, Black-$79, And Calico rare!-$129. I saw a cute little color point (similar to a siamese color pattern) that i was interested in. I asked to see it and they brought it out to me. They then proceeded to tell me that She was $300 because she was an egyptian mau. This breed of cat does not come with points, ever. Not even as kittens. . Nor do they have blue eyes, which this kitten did, along with subtle stripes-thus not a pure bred mau. I brought this to their attention and she tried to tell me they get more spots later.The Mau is born with spots. In other words, they are trying to sell a domestic shorthair (mixed kitten) for $300 as a pure bred (with no papers).

I have been working in the animal care field for 20 years and i think this deceit is horrible. Some poor person is going to pay that money thinking they have a rare spotted cat, when really they just bought a normal dsh.....That's fraud
